How many sets are usually played in tennis?
A set is collection of games, played until a player wins six games (or more). A match is played to a best-of-three or five sets. Usually, championship matches are played to five sets.

How many sets are played in a match?
Matches employ either a best-of-three (first to two sets wins) or best-of-five (first to three sets wins) set format. The best-of-five set format is usually only used in the men’s singles or doubles matches at Grand Slam and Davis Cup matches.
Is Wimbledon first to 3 sets?
Most professional men’s tennis matches are played in a best-of-three sets format, with 6 games (and a possible tiebreak) in each set. In Grand Slams (Australian Open, French Open, Wimbledon, and US Open), men play best-of-five sets, which means that players need to win 3 sets to win the match.
Are all Grand Slam 5 sets?
Only the best tennis players in the world qualify for these events. At Grand Slam tournaments, the men’s main draw matches are played as 3 out of 5 sets. At Wimbledon, men play 2 out of 3 sets until the final round of the qualifying, where they play 3 out of 5. Women’s Grand Slam matches are always 2 out of 3 sets.
How many sets can you play in a Wimbledon match?
A men’s match at Wimbledon can have a minimum of 3 and maximum of 5 sets (excluding the possibly of retirements through injury). A player has to win at least 3 sets to win a match. A set is determined when a player has won a minimum of six games with at least a two game advantage over his or her opponent.

How many sets do you have to win to win tennis?
A player has to win at least 3 sets to win a match. A set is determined when a player has won a minimum of six games with at least a two game advantage over his or her opponent. The potential score outcome for a set could be 6-4, 6-3, 6-2, 6-1, or 6-0.
How many days did the first Wimbledon Championship last?
The inaugural 1877 Wimbledon Championship started on 9 July 1877 and the Gentlemen’s Singles was the only event held. 22 men paid a guinea to enter the tournament, which was to be held over five days. The rain delayed it four more days and thus, on 19 July 1877, the final was played.
